Intra Operative Neurophysiologic Monitoring, often known as IONM, allows clinicians to track electrical activity within the brain, spinal cord, and peripheral nerves while a patient is under anesthesia. By continuously measuring these signals throughout surgery, our team can detect subtle changes that may indicate neurological stress. When a concern arises, we alert the surgical staff immediately so they can take action before long-term complications develop.
